The intervertebral disc in the human spine acts as a separator to hold the spinal bones apart, the vertebrae, apart and permits motion of the spine. The disc also provides a large opening for the nerves exiting the spine through which to pass. If this opening is thinned, which occurs when discs degenerate and lose height, the nerves passing through are compressed. This compression slows circulation to the nerve and inflammation of the nerve begins. The shrinking of the nerve opening is termed Minster spinal stenosis. A SPRING
The intervertebral disc acts like a spring to keep the vertebra apart. The normal disc therefore works to stop nerve compression and to allow spinal motion. When the disc degenerates, or thins, it allows the adjacent vertebra to move nearer one another, resulting in motion loss, nerve compression, and pain in the back or down the arms or legs. What keeps the intervertebral disc height? Normal discs contain a chemical called glycosaminoglycan (GAG) which allows the disc to absorb water from the fluid moving into the disc. Actually, the interior of a healthy disc is 80% water. The GAG content of the disc’s interior reduces significantly with degeneration, thus reducing the water content of the disc. The loss of water in the disc because of GAG loss is called degeneration. Disc degeneration reduces the ability of the disc to resist motion by over 65%. The incapacity to control motion of the vertebrae is termed instability. (1)
